David M. Kennedy the Donald J. McLachlan Professor of History at Stanford University is a native of Seattle and a 1963 Stanford graduate. He received his Ph.D. from Yale University in 1968. A renowned teacher he has been honored with the Dean's Award for Distinguished Teaching and has three times been selected by graduating Stanford seniors as Class Day Speaker.
He has taught American history at the University of Florence Italy and has lectured on American history in Germany Finland Denmark Turkey Canada Australia and Ireland. In 1995-1996 he served as the Harmsworth Professor of American history at Oxford University.
